Vinous Josh Raynolds - 01 Jan 10
Inky purple. Deeper and more powerful on the nose than the Chaillot, displaying pungent aromas of cassis, boysenberry, violet, dark chocolate and licorice. Surprisingly lithe on the palate following the richness of the nose, offering vibrant dark berry flavors and a note of refreshingly bitter cherry skin. Turns spicier with air, finishing with strong cut and a persistent floral quality. I really like this wine's blend of masculine character and vibrancy.

Cornas

Cornas, a prestigious Northern Rhône appellation, is famous for bold, robust Syrah wines. Grown on steep, sun-drenched slopes, these wines are known for their intensity and depth, featuring flavours of dark berries, black pepper, smoked meat, and earthy notes, with strong tannins and excellent ageing potential. Cornas focuses exclusively on 100% Syrah, with granite soils adding to its complexity. Top producers include Domaine Auguste Clape, Thierry Allemand, and Domaine Alain Voge, all celebrated for expressing Cornas's unique terroir.
